Montpellier

Montpellier is the 8th largest city of France, and also has been the fastest growing city in the country over the past 25 years. Graceful and easy-going, Montpellier is a stylish metropolis with elegant buildings, grand hotels, private mansions, stately boulevards and shady backstreets, and gorgeous white-sand beaches on its doorstep. Unlike many southern towns, Montpellier has no Roman heritage. Instead it was founded in the 10th century by the counts of Toulouse and later became a prosperous trading port as well as a scholarly center - Europe's first medical school was established here in the 12th century. The population swelled in the 1960s when many French settlers left independent Algeria and relocated here, and it's now France's fastest-growing city and one of its most multicultural areas. Students make up over a third of the population, giving it a spirited vibe.

Costa Vicentina

Costa Vicentina is the beautiful coastal area in southwest Portugal which runs through both the Algarve and Alentejo Regions along the southern coast. This is actually part of the longest stretch of protected coastline in Portugal, making it one of the best places to experience the unadulterated beauty and nature of the country. Costa Vicentina offers miles of some of the best Portugal beaches, fantastic hiking trails, and lovely old villages to explore. The area sees far more Portuguese tourists than international ones, so expect Portuguese to be the only language spoken by many people, especially in the smaller villages.

The average daily cost (per person) in Montpellier is €140, while the average daily cost in Costa Vicentina is €150. These costs include accommodation (assuming double occupancy, so the traveler is sharing the room), food, transportation, and entertainment. While every person is different, these costs are an average of past travelers in each destination.
